As well as fighting to protect and improve your jobs, pay and workplace rights, CPSU members can often be found making a difference in the broader NT community. Whether it’s showing solidarity for military veterans or collecting food and toys for folks doing it tough, CPSU member are happy to lend a hand where we can. Below are some recent examples. Foodbank


In November 2022 the CPSU helped co-ordinate a foodbank collection which saw more than 300kg of food collected from around a dozen workplaces around the NT on behalf of the good folk at Foodbank NT


Toy Drive for Flood victims


Early 2023 numerous remote NT communities had been devastated by flooding. Lead by CPSU organisers Dawn McQuilkin and Eli Morris, CPSU made and collected toys from both APS and NTPS workplaces and drove the toys to Katherine NT where they were distributed to impacted families.
 

Walking off the war within


Walking off the war within is a charity walk for veterans. The CPSU was proud to support this cause by participating in the walk and by giving and encouraging donations.
 

Breast Cancer Awareness


Organisers held a breast cancer awareness morning tea which raised over $300 for the charity.
